Difference between Max Factor and Revlon

Max Factor vs. Revlon

Max Factor is a line of cosmetics from Coty, founded in 1909 as Max Factor & Company by Maksymilian Faktorowicz. Revlon, Inc. is an American multinational company dealing in cosmetics, skin care, perfume, and personal care.
